Trying to sell what I consider a unicorn over on the CMP site.

Its a pre WWII NOS Springfield Armory M1903 stock. The pre wars had a slim elegant profile that Keystones and modern makers haven't been able to match.

7r3p6Xcl.jpg


UcnqJPQl.jpg


8vqTHkCl.jpg


It was intended I would buy a barreled action and make a match grade Unertl/1903 combo out of it. Its pretty boring as far as grain goes but for shooting purposes/strength that straight grain is perfect.

Ill miss not putting multiple coats of linseed on it but it needs a good home.
